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
099618 658398 540
931533775 99259 34509417552
931533775 99259 34509417552
49567173039 88 576
All about undefined
Interested in learning more?
931533775 99259 34509417552
49567173039 88 576
See more
594652115 2269517673
44766930 09330806 8358 98620145032 6936
See more
43 008
622 56 0053597232
See more